About Kenny Schoemig

Hi, my name is William Kenneth Schoemig, but you can call me Kenny. I am a husband, father, educator, trivia connoisseur, and Utah native.

​

My love for education started when I was young. For as long as I can remember, my mom would buy me books for any occasion. I loved reading and learning about dinosaurs, ancient cities, and fantastical adventures. I would read anything I could get my hands on, even some really fantastic cereal boxes. I want to help my students see how reading is a powerful tool for learning.

​

I hope to emulate my grandfather, who was a high school history teacher and coach. He was a firm believer in teaching his students to be inquisitive and think for themselves. I want to help my students develop a natural curiosity that will lead to lifelong learning.

​

My desire to teach Deaf students comes from my experience growing up with Deaf parents. I am a firsthand witness to their determination, intellect, and resiliency. I aim to empower my students with these qualities, so that they can set and achieve high goals.

​

My hope is to make a difference in the classroom by sharing my love for reading, engendering curiosity, and by empowering my students with self-confidence. I want the kids to see that I am excited to be there and I want to help them learn.
